THE MARAROA.
Tho s.s. Mararoa, 2,466 tons, Capb. Chabfield, arrived in porb lasb evening at 9.30 o'clock from Sydney, after a rabher protracted trip across. She was delayed by bad weather. She left Sydney ab 5.45 p.m. on bhe sth insb. and had strong S.E. wind and heavy head sea from the start right across. She breasted the Three Kings at 10 p.m. on the 9bh and rounded North Cape at 2.30 yesberday morning. She passed a ship sbanding N.E. ab 4 p.m. on Monday.
